radon-h2020 / radon-gmt

🔀 RADON Graphical Modeling Tool based on Eclipse Winery
https://winery.readthedocs.io
Apache License 2.0
2 stars 5 forks source link

[R-T4.3-14] Manage RADON Models from RADON Template Publishing Service #30

Open miwurster opened 4 years ago

miwurster commented 4 years ago
ID R-T4.3-14
Section WP4: Modeling Environment
Type FUNCTIONAL_SUITABILITY
User Story As a Software Developer, I want to manage my RADON Models using the RADON Template Publishing Service.
Requirement Push and load RADON Models to or from the RADON Template Publishing Service once users decide to finalize a model or want to modify an existing one.
Extended Description The GMT must be able to push RADON Models to the RADON Template Publishing Service once users decide to finalize a model and put it into production. Similarly, the GMT needs to be able to pull a model from the service to modify it and push it as a new version back.
Affected Tools GRAPHMODEL_TOOL
Means of Verification Manual testing based on case studies.
Dependency N/A
miwurster commented 4 years ago

@gcasale please approve new requirement.

gcasale commented 4 years ago

Approved.

Note: the description is not meant to discuss the TPS but the requirement, the part that should be kept is primarily "Therefore, ...".

miwurster commented 4 years ago

@gcasale please review and approve.

XLB and UST agreed to integrate the Template Library Publishing Service (TLS) with an IDE plugin to query and publish TOSCA types and models. We noticed lately that it makes more sense to use Winery (GMT) only as an editor and the IDE to commit, publish, and update your models with the TLS. This will be then a similar workflow as in traditional software engineering where you use an IDE to write your code and then Git to commit and push. Therefore, we fulfill this requirement by implementing an Eclipse Che plugin to establish the connection between the TLS and IDE.

gcasale commented 4 years ago

As this is not critical for exploitation we can go for this change. Approved.

On Tue, 8 Sep 2020, 13:43 Michael Wurster, notifications@github.com wrote:

@gcasale https://github.com/gcasale please review and approve.

XLB and UST agreed to integrate the Template Library Publishing Service (TLS) with an IDE plugin to query and publish TOSCA types and models. We noticed lately that it makes more sense to use Winery (GMT) only as an editor and the IDE to commit, publish, and update your models with the TLS. This will be then a similar workflow as in traditional software engineering where you use an IDE to write your code and then Git to commit and push. Therefore, we fulfill this requirement by implementing an Eclipse Che plugin to establish the connection between the TLS and IDE.

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Hub https://github.com/radon-h2020/radon-gmt/issues/30#issuecomment-688840975, or unsubscribe https://github.com/notifications/unsubscribe-auth/ABDBKEG4WLDE3XB2MEZOFIDSEYRHNANCNFSM4NYOV54A .